$1,500 New Hire Bonus for 2nd Shift

Location: Onsite – Kenosha, WI
Shift: 2nd Shift | Monday–Thursday, 2:30 PM – 12:00 AM (includes shift differential)

At EXALTA Group, our work matters—we help deliver innovative medical technologies that improve and save lives. We’re seeking Assembly Technicians at all experience levels to join our team at our Kenosha, WI facility.

Whether you’re just starting your career or bringing years of experience, this is your opportunity to build technical skills, contribute to a high-performing team, and be part of something bigger—where your work makes a real difference every day.

What You’ll Do

  • Assemble precision medical device components and subassemblies using tools, equipment, and approved procedures
  • Follow blueprints, work instructions, and torque specifications to ensure product quality
  • Perform assembly tasks such as gluing, painting, and component bonding
  • Conduct in-process quality checks to maintain compliance and performance standards
  • Troubleshoot assembly processes and workflow issues as needed
  • Maintain accurate documentation and production records within ERP systems
  • Support workflow efficiency, inventory tracking, and preventative maintenance efforts
  • Keep a clean, organized, and safe work environment
  • Meet production, quality, and efficiency targets
  • Cross-train and support additional operations as needed

What You Bring

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• 1–3 years of mechanical assembly experience preferred
  • Experience in ISO or FDA-regulated environments is a plus
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ints and technical work instructions
  • Strong attention to detail and manual dexterity
  • Basic math skills and mechanical aptitude
  • Ability to work independently and collaborate within a team

Work Environment & Physical Requirements

  • Temperature-controlled manufacturing setting
  • Exposure to machinery, hand tools, and chemicals
  • Ability to stand or sit for extended periods (up to 12 hours)
  • Lift up to 50 lbs as needed
  • Perform repetitive movements, bending, and twisting
